4/22/08 11:17:18 AM#16
Also, seems quite funny that the PVP Beta weekend was a huge success from just about every single poster here on these forums. Also, don't fault Funcom for something that is Fileplanet's doing, ie charging people to get access to the open beta. Fileplanet has done this for ages with just about every single game that they have hosted for downloads. Companies go to them for betas because they have so much experience with the hosting of these huge files. Not that they are what the companies want to use, but they have little choices at a time when they are trying to finish up production of their games.
They go with places like Fileplanet out of necessity, not because they necessarily want to do so. |
